I'm wanting to replace the gearbox oil on my manual box. Can anyone recommend the correct oil to use and how much it takes. Cheers Jay

I used Millers 75w80 in mine, same viscosity as factory fill and a brand I trust to make very high quality oils.

If it meets the spec you can't go wrong. But there is the argument that the BMW fill favours economy over protection, so don't be afraid to go to other reputable brands with similar viscosities.

Either way, changing it is better than leaving it in. Mine wasn't nice but didn't appear to have much in the way of metallic particles in, though I didn't have it analysed.
